Step 1: Dry the Place Out Without question, the most important step a homeowner needs to take when faced with flood or other water damage is to waste no time in drying the area out. As mentioned earlier, the old ways of setting up all of your house fans to dry out a flooded basement or structure isn't very effective in the long run. Flood restoration teams have determined that fans may do a satisfactory job on the surface, but leave deeper water damage to walls, wood, carpet and furniture unchecked. That unseen damage can lead to more serious consequences such as mold and mildew growth, the flourishing of harmful bacteria, and in extreme conditions, actual damage to the structural integrity of the home itself. What to Expect With any flood damage cleanup project, expect a full on assault on affected area from the get-go. A good flood damage cleanup specialist will set up dehumidifiers, air purifiers, blowers, fans, and special floor driers quickly and efficiently to dry out your water damaged home. Besides these standard steps, and depending on the extent of the damage, your flood damage cleanup technician might also employ the use of wall driers, sanitizers, and mold and mildew remediation techniques. In the Long Run The full extent of the steps that need to be taken could be much greater, however. The amount of water damage and the time passed before a flood damage cleanup crew was called in, will determine the size and cost of the project.
